Attend a series of award lectures showcasing innovative research and contributions in space science. Begin with the inaugural William B. Hanson lecture, recognizing innovative approaches to observation and interpretation that advance understanding of the Space Environment. Continue with presentations from recipients of the Fred Scarf award for outstanding dissertation research, the Basu United States and International Early Career awards for contributions to Sun-Earth Systems Science, and the Space Physics and Aeronomy Richard Carrington award for impact on students and public understanding. Explore topics including space science methodology, engaging young students in scientific research, high-latitude ionospheric dynamics, coherent structures in turbulent plasma, and shock waves and nonlinear plasma waves mediated by pickup ions and energetic particles. Gain insights from leading researchers in the field during this comprehensive 1 hour and 34 minute session presented by AGU.
